acs uni,acs uni: A Comprehensive Guide to Uni-App Development
0 4分钟 2 月

acs uni: A Comprehensive Guide to Uni-App Development

Are you looking to develop a cross-platform application that works seamlessly across iOS, Android, and the web? Look no further than uni-app, a powerful framework that allows developers to create apps using Vue.js. In this article, we’ll dive deep into the world of uni-app, exploring its features, benefits, and how to get started with your own project.

What is uni-app?

acs uni,acs uni: A Comprehensive Guide to Uni-App Development

uni-app is an open-source framework that enables developers to build applications for multiple platforms using a single codebase. It’s based on Vue.js, a progressive JavaScript framework, and provides a rich set of features to help you create high-performance, cross-platform apps.

Key Features of uni-app

Here are some of the key features that make uni-app stand out from other cross-platform frameworks:

Feature Description
Cross-platform compatibility uni-app supports iOS, Android, H5, and various app platforms like WeChat, Alipay, and Baidu.
Single codebase Developers can write code once and deploy it to multiple platforms, saving time and effort.
Rich UI components uni-app provides a wide range of UI components that are easy to use and customize.
Extensive API support uni-app offers a comprehensive API set that allows developers to access device features and perform various tasks.
Hot reload uni-app supports hot reload, allowing developers to see the changes in real-time without restarting the app.

Getting Started with uni-app

Before you start developing with uni-app, you’ll need to set up your development environment. Here’s a step-by-step guide to get you started:

  1. Install Node.js and npm

  2. Install HBuilderX, an integrated development environment (IDE) for uni-app development

  3. Open HBuilderX and create a new uni-app project

  4. Customize your project settings and start coding

Developing with uni-app

Once you have your uni-app project set up, you can start developing your app. Here are some tips to help you get started:

  1. Use Vue.js components and syntax to build your UI

  2. Utilize the uni-app API to access device features and perform tasks

  3. Test your app on different platforms to ensure compatibility

  4. Optimize your app’s performance and user experience

uni-app Plugins

uni-app offers a wide range of plugins that can help you extend the functionality of your app. Here are some popular plugins:

  • uView: A comprehensive UI framework for uni-app

  • uCharts: A chart library for uni-app

  • uView UI: A UI component library for uni-app

  • uView UI Pro: A premium UI component library for uni-app

Best Practices for uni-app Development

Here are some best practices to help you develop high-quality uni-app applications:

  • Follow the uni-app development guidelines and best practices

  • Use version control to manage your codebase

  • Test your app thoroughly on different devices and platforms

  • Stay up-to-date with the latest uni-app updates and features

Conclusion

uni-app is a powerful and versatile framework that can help you create high-quality, cross-platform applications. By following this comprehensive guide, you’ll be well on your way